Kopecký won the Hustopeče Rally for the eighth time, returning last year’s defeat to Pech

“It was as challenging here as every year. Today it was really hot again and we sweated a lot, but it used to be worse. Today we are satisfied. After the first section it looked like Venca would go in front of us, we slightly changed the car settings as I did he felt it could work, and it helped, “Kopecký told autosport.cz.

The 40-year-old pilot took the lead behind the wheel of the Fabia in the fourth part of the Championship in the last special stage on Friday, when he moved ahead of Pech, and in the remaining six tests the order did not change in the first three places. Each of the trio of aspirants added at least one partial championship to the victory. Kopecký was the fastest three times, Pech twice and Mareš in the final test.

“In the afternoon at the first two rehearsals, I was surprised that we managed to bounce off Vašek, and then I was sure that if I didn’t ruin it somewhere, I could watch it,” said Kopecký.

The eight-time Czech champion triumphed in a popular competition among Moravian vineyards for the first time since 2018, when he won for the fourth time in a row. He did not find a winner here even in 2011-13. He returned last year’s six-second defeat to the four-time winner Pech, Mareš repeated third place.

“I’m so sorry that everything was decided by one test, which we couldn’t influence. The ride was otherwise fantastic and it was a great duel. Friday’s final stage, when he lagged behind Kopecký by six seconds due to dust on the track and only a minute gap between the cars. “Today we tried and rode to the fullest. We were a fantastic sport, tugged and we could have decided it on the last line,” he said, adding that he still has the enthusiasm for a big battle for first place.

Kopecký strengthened the lead at the head of the championship over Mareš. Pech, who won the Wallachian Rally at the beginning of the season, starts with a WRC category car and his results do not count towards the championship series.

The next race of the Championship will be the Bohemia Rally Mladá Boleslav on July 9 and 10.

Rallye Hustopeče, race of the Czech Republic championship in car competitions:
1. Kopecký, Hloušek (Škoda Fabia Rally2 Evo) 1: 18: 12.4
2. Pech, Uhel (Ford Focus WRC) -6.3
3. Mareš, Bucha (Škoda Fabia Rally2 Evo) -11.5
4. Stritesky, Hovorka (Skoda Fabia R5) -2: 05.5
5. Grzyb, Borko (Pol./ Škoda Fabia Rally2 Evo) -2: 27.4
6. J. Melichárek, E. Melichárek (SR / Ford Fiesta RS WRC) -3: 40.0
7. Vlcek, Skripova (Hyundai i20 N Rally2) -4: 05.7
8. Cvrček, Šálek (Škoda Fabia Rally2 Evo) -4: 42.7
Current standings of the Czech Championships:
1. Kopecký 231
2. Mareš 192
3. Stříteský 126
